![]() ![]() However, following the new updates to the Rolex catalog for 2021, these 'Wimbledon' dials can now be found on both 36mm and 41mm Datejust models.įirst introduced in 1945 to celebrate the company's 40th anniversary, the Datejust was the world's first self-winding waterproof wrist chronometer to display the date of the month through a window on the dial. Previously, these unique dials were exclusively fitted to the various 41mm Datejust references. One important note is that the green and blue versions of these pattern dials are only fitted to either stainless steel or White Rolesor references, the champagne ones are exclusive to the Yellow Rolesor models, and the silver variants are the ones only going to be found on the Everose Rolesor Datejust 36 watches.Īdditionally, the fan-favorite 'Wimbledon' dial - which is characterized by its sunburst slate surface with painted Roman numeral markers outlined in bright green - is now also available for the various Rolex Datejust 36 models. ![]() Meanwhile, the fluted motif dial is offered in blue, champagne, or silver. The palm motif dial is available in either green, champagne, or silver. The vast majority of the new dials are exclusively available on the 36mm models from the Datejust range, with the most noteworthy additions being the ones that feature patterns (either a 'palm' or 'fluted' motif) laser-engraved on their surfaces. For 2021, Rolex did not introduce any entirely new Datejust references to the catalog however, the historic Swiss watch manufacturer did add a few new dial options to the collection. ![]()
